Yunusa says teenager’s mum was aware of their trip to Kano

Yunusa shocked everyone when he disclosed in court that Ese’s mother also knew of his relationship with her daughter.

 

Vanguard reports that Yunusa shocked everyone when he disclosed that Ese’s mother also knew of his relationship with her daughter.

He also confirmed that Ese’s father did not know anything about his relationship with the teenager.

The accused also agreed that he impregnated her, but that he was not aware she was pregnant until the police test revealed it.

You will recall that Ese refused to return home, without her supposed lover,despite pleas from government officials.

ADVERTISEMENT

The teenager also said she came to Kano by herself, adding that nobody abducted her.

The teenager was allegedly abducted sometime in 2015 by Yunusa and was taken to Kano, where she was reportedly forced to convert to Islam.
